Genealogy Pot en Smit » CORNELIS PAS (1863-1931)

Personal data CORNELIS PAS 


Household of CORNELIS PAS

(1) He is married to ADRIANA HORDIJK.

They got married on April 2, 1891 at CHARLOIS, he was 28 years old.Source 3


(2) He is married to JOHANNA GEERTRUIDA FROSCHHART.

They got married on August 24, 1922 at ROTTERDAM, he was 59 years old.Source 4
